2 Bath Row, Clydach, Abergavenny, NP7 0NF is a freehold terraced property built before 1900. The property offers approximately 732 square feet of living space. In this location, properties of similar size usually have two bedrooms.

The estimated current market value of the property is £199,605 , which equates to approximately £273 per square foot. It was last sold on 2 Sep 2022 for £200,000. Since then, the value has decreased by £395, representing a 0.2% decrease, or approximately 0.1% per year.

2 Bath Row, Clydach, Abergavenny, Monmouthshire, NP7 0NF has an Energy Performance Certificate (EPC) rating of E, based on the latest assessment carried out on 26 Feb 2026.

This property uses electric room heaters as its main heating source. An off-peak electric immersion heater is used to provide hot water, supplemented by a solar water heating system. The windows are high performance glazing.

The previous EPC assessment was conducted on 10 Feb 2021. The rating of E remains the same, but the energy efficiency score improved by 12.8%.

Since the previous assessment, several changes were observed:

  • The heating system was upgraded from electric storage heaters to room heaters, electric, changing energy efficiency from average to poor.
  • The hot water system changed from electric immersion, off-peak to electric immersion, off-peak, plus solar, with no change in energy efficiency (average).
  • The roof construction or insulation changed from pitched, no insulation (assumed) to pitched, no insulation, with no change in energy efficiency (very poor).
  • The wall construction or insulation changed from sandstone or limestone, as built, no insulation (assumed) to sandstone, as built, no insulation (assumed), with no change in energy efficiency (very poor).
  • The windows were upgraded from fully double glazed to high performance glazing.
  • The lighting was updated from low energy lighting in all fixed outlets to good lighting efficiency, with efficiency changing from very good to good.
